Advanced 5-Axis Machining

Our workshop integrates advanced multi-axis machining technology. By combining milling and turning operations, we eliminate multiple set-ups, drastically reducing human error while maintaining positioning tolerances below the ±0.005mm threshold.

DFM Feedback within 24 Hours

Our experienced engineering team evaluates the Design for Manufacturability (DFM) of every STEP file. We identify draft issues, corner radius limitations, and material waste opportunities before production begins, lowering cost-per-part metrics for Parisian startups and OEMs.

Frequently Asked Questions (FAQ)

Providing clear, straightforward technical answers for engineers and purchasing agents ordering CNC components.

What is the standard lead time for shipping CNC machined parts from China to Paris?

Our standard production lead time for prototypes is 3–7 business days, while volume manufacturing runs generally take 15–20 business days. Standard air freight from our Dongguan facility to Paris (CDG Airport) takes approximately 3–5 business days, and sea shipping takes 30–35 days.

Can you provide material traceabilities and certifications for French industrial compliance?

Yes. Every batch of machined components is delivered with official raw-material test certificates (conforming to EN 10204 3.1) showing physical and chemical properties. We also supply certificates of conformity and RoHS/REACH compliance reports upon request.

How does Dongguan SX Technology guarantee tolerances for precision parts?

We maintain strict ISO 9001:2015 control guidelines. Our climate-controlled inspection room features coordinate measuring machines (CMM), height gauges, profile projectors, and thread gauges. Standard tolerances are ISO 2768-m (medium) or f (fine), with critical dimensions held up to ±0.005mm.

Which 3D/2D CAD formats do you accept for quoting?

For 3D data, we accept STEP (.step, .stp), IGES (.iges, .igs), and SolidWorks files (.sldprt). For 2D engineering drawings (critical for marking tolerances, surface finishes, and thread specifications), we prefer PDF, DWG, or DXF formats.

What surface treatment finishes can you apply?

We provide a comprehensive range of finishes, including bead blasting, clear and color anodizing (Type II and Type III hardcoat), passivation, electroplating (zinc, nickel, chrome), powder coating, laser engraving, and electropolishing for stainless steels.
